The “Hypochondriac” Hero in the Early Tragedies of A.P. Sumarokov
Abstract
V.K. Trediakovsky, criticizing the tragedy of A.P. Sumarokov “Khorev”, draws attention to the character of one of its heroes, Kiy, whom Trediakovsky calls “hypochondriac”. Those features that the critic probably invested in the definition of a hypochondriac are also represented in the image of another character Sumarokov: in the tragedy “Semira” they are found in Oleg, who also performs the function of a ruler. A comparison of these heroes allows us to establish that Sumarokov not only does not avoid the traits criticized by Trediakovsky, but also develops the created model, improves the image of the hypochondriac ruler. The special psychological certainty that this hero characterizes can be explained by the autopsychological principle of this character.
